Tissue Engineered Products (TEP) are products that are created using tissue engineering techniques to mimic the function of native tissues in the body. These products have gained significant attention in the medical field for their potential to heal injuries, repair damaged tissues, and even regenerate organs.

- Tissue-engineered Medicines
Tissue Engineered Products (TEP) market includes three main types: Tissue Engineered Skin, which involves the production of artificial skin for burn victims or patients with skin disorders; Tissue Engineered Bones, which focuses on creating synthetic bone grafts for orthopedic surgeries or bone defects; and Tissue-engineered Medicines market, which aims to develop personalized medicine using tissue engineering techniques. These innovative products have the potential to revolutionize the healthcare industry by providing alternative treatment options and improving patient outcomes.

What are the Emerging Trends in the Global Tissue Engineered Products (TEP) market?
The global Tissue Engineered Products (TEP) market is witnessing several emerging trends, such as the increasing focus on regenerative medicine and personalized healthcare, advancements in 3D bioprinting technology, and the growing adoption of stem cell therapy. Current trends include the rising demand for off-the-shelf tissue engineered products, the development of novel biomaterials for tissue regeneration, and the expansion of applications in orthopedics, wound healing, and cardiovascular disease treatment. Additionally, collaborations between academia, industry, and regulatory bodies are driving innovation in TEP, while stringent regulatory standards are shaping the market landscape and promoting product quality and safety.

Major Market Players
Some of the key players in the Tissue Engineered Products (TEP) market include Acelity ., Inc., Integra LifeSciences Corporation, Organogenesis, Inc, Johnson & Johnson, and Zimmer Biomet.
Acelity L.P., Inc. is a global advanced wound care company that offers a range of products for wound management and surgical solutions. The company has a strong market presence and is focused on innovation and development of new products in the TEP market.
Integra LifeSciences Corporation is a leading medical technology company that specializes in regenerative tissue products for orthopedic and spine surgery. The company has been experiencing steady market growth due to its broad product portfolio and strategic partnerships.
Organogenesis, Inc. is a pioneer in the field of regenerative medicine, offering advanced wound care products and surgical solutions. The company has been expanding its market reach through acquisitions and collaborations, which has contributed to its rapid growth in the TEP market.
Zimmer Biomet is a global leader in musculoskeletal healthcare, providing a wide range of products for bone and joint reconstruction, spinal surgery, and sports medicine. The company has a strong presence in the TEP market and continues to grow through product innovation and strategic acquisitions.
